ALEXANDRIA, Va., Oct. 28 -- United States Patent no. 12,448,512, issued on Oct. 21, was assigned to UT-BATTELLE LLC (Oak Ridge, Tenn.) and FIBERLEAN TECHNOLOGIES Ltd. (Par, Great Britain).
"Surface-modified and dried microfibrillated cellulose reinforced thermoplastic biocomposites" was invented by Soydan Ozcan (Oak Ridge, Tenn.), Kai Li (Knoxville, Tenn.), Halil Tekinalp (Knoxville, Tenn.), Xianhui Zhao (Oak Ridge, Tenn.), Jon Phipps (Gorran Haven, Great Britain) and Sean Ireland (Hampden, Maine).
